Power Pairing: Glycolic Acid + Alpha Arbutin

Glycolic Acid + Alpha Arbutin: Use With Caution

Popularity: 83%
4/5

Glycolic Acid with Alpha Arbutin can be effective, but skin tolerance determines success. This pairing can work, but requires conservative frequency and barrier support.

The Synergy

The pair can still be part of one regimen when scheduled carefully (for example alternating nights or splitting AM/PM). The key is controlled frequency and strong barrier support.

Combined Benefits

Refined texture through controlled cell turnover
Brighter skin surface and improved product absorption
Better pore clarity for congestion-prone areas
More even-looking skin tone over time
Targeted support for visible dark marks

How to Layer (Step-by-Step Guide)

1

Introduce Slowly

1

Begin 2-3 times weekly, not daily from day one.

2

Split Timing

2

Use Alpha Arbutin in AM and the other in PM when possible.

3

Buffer Skin

3

Use a moisturizer before or after actives if skin is reactive.

4

Monitor Tolerance

4

Reduce frequency if redness, stinging, or flaking persists.

5

Protect Daily

5

Use sunscreen every morning to protect progress.
